Everything we tried at Maria’s was excellent. The chips were warm and flavorful and the salsa was delicious. I had a small combination plate and it was a generous amount of food. Mine included an enchilada with red sauce, a smothered chili verde burrito, and a taco! It was piping hot and so delicious—I love the contrast of the red and green sauces. The taco was probably my favorite thing! The meat was so so good and the fresh lettuce, tomatoes and cheese were perfect on the homemade shell. My boys tried the birria tacos and they inhaled them! My husband had the large combination plate and our daughter tried the street tacos. We were all stuffed and took some food home. The service was top notch—our server Jesus was fun, helpful, and attentive. After we ordered, our food was out fast! I was shocked when the plates started coming out to our table. We’ve already talked about going back. I want to try the Al Pastor burrito! Definitely try this place! Our overall experience was that good!Kid-friendliness: They have a kids menu and staff is attentive and accommodating. This is a very family friendly restaurant.

It was a Saturday night, prime time, so it was busy and there was a wait to be seated. They need more space for people to sit or stand while waiting to be seated. They don't take reservations, but the wait time was only about 10 mins. The server was great. We didn't get our food in a timely manner, but the server was communicative about the delay. The chips and salsa were tasty, but the main course was bland and meh. I got the chile verde chimichanga. The pork was overcooked and not much flavor. My husband got the mole enchiladas. The mole had zero flavor. Our friend got a grilled chicken burrito and said the tortilla tasted strange. We were not impressed. Probably won't go back.
